When Atomfall was introduced as a part of the Xbox Video games Showcase earlier this summer season, its first-person, post-apocalypse, alt-history design made it seem...
There’s an uncomfortable sense among the many gaming group, as business layoff numbers stack up, mission after mission is cancelled, and as console life cycles...